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P на примерах (2 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

HTML+CSS+JavaScript

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Запись HTML в <IFRAME>
 
 автор: Blaster   (07.06.2008 в 21:58)   письмо автору
 
 

Вот, столкнулся с новой проблемой.
есть 2 файла: index.html и src.html.
src.html - почти пучтой файл, его код такой:

<html>
    <body style="background-color:green;">
    </body>
</html>


Код index.html:
<iframe id="myframe" src="src.html"></iframe>

нужно с помощью JS скрипта в файле index.html вписать во фрейм HTML-код.

функцией innerHTML это сделать мне не удалось (но, наверно я не правильно что-то делал.)

Единственное, что у меня получилось, это с помощью скрипта
frames.myframe.document.write("<b>asd</b>");

вписать туда жирным шрифтом буквы asd:)

Но, эта функция мне не подходит. Нужно вставить длинный текст с HTML кодом в несколько строк.
Кто знает, как можно реализовать задачу, откликнитесь! Заранее спасибо!

   
 
 автор: admin   (08.06.2008 в 00:33)   письмо автору
 
   для: Blaster   (07.06.2008 в 21:58)
 

попробуй это
<iframe src="131.html" width=200 height=100 frameborder=1>
Здесь можно разместить текст для браузеров отличных от IE 4.0.
</iframe>

может поможет!!!

   
 
 автор: PAT   (08.06.2008 в 02:28)   письмо автору
 
   для: Blaster   (07.06.2008 в 21:58)
 

var mycode = "А это мой длинный \n";
mycode += "и в несколько строк \n";
mycode += "код HTML вместе с тегами <b>любого</b> типа, \n";
mycode += "исключая тег SCRIPT - его нельзя просто так вписывать -\n";
mycode += "обязательно надо разбивать на составные части\n";
mycode += "например, так: <SCR" + "IPT>";

window.frames.myframe.document.body.innerHTML = mycode;

   
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ования